Role & Responsibilities:
- Manage AWS RDS SQL Server databases
- Monitor system's health and performance via AWS Console and other tools
- Analyse, solve, and correct performance issues in real time
- Provide suggestions for solutions
- Refine and automate regular processes, track issues, and document changes
- Assist developers with query tuning and schema refinement
- Rectify developers SQL code from the point of performance impact
- Perform scheduled maintenance and support release deployment activities after hours
- Run ad-hoc query from the management and support teams
- Provide bug-hunting support on the SQL server. Change code (procedures, views, function, triggers) to correct a bug
- Create and Restore Native backup for AWS RDS
